As a plastic surgeon in Memphis, I can provide you with an overview of the pain associated with Mentor breast implants. Mentor is a reputable manufacturer of breast implants that are commonly used in cosmetic and reconstructive breast surgeries.
The level of pain experienced by patients with Mentor breast implants can vary depending on several factors, such as the type of surgical procedure, the individual's pain tolerance, and the post-operative recovery process. It's important to note that all surgical procedures come with some degree of discomfort, and breast augmentation is no exception.
During the surgical procedure, patients may experience some pain and discomfort. This is typically managed with the use of anesthesia and pain medication. The surgeon will make incisions to create a pocket for the implant, either under the breast tissue (subglandular) or under the chest muscle (submuscular). The level of pain experienced during this stage can vary, but it is generally well-controlled with appropriate pain management.
After the surgery, patients can expect to experience some degree of soreness, swelling, and bruising. This is a normal part of the healing process and is typically more pronounced in the first few days following the procedure. Patients may need to take pain medication and use ice packs to help manage this discomfort. The level of pain and the duration of the recovery period can vary from person to person.
It's important for patients to follow the post-operative instructions provided by their surgeon, which may include wearing a supportive bra, avoiding strenuous activities, and keeping the incision sites clean and dry. Adhering to these instructions can help minimize discomfort and promote a smooth recovery.
Overall, the level of pain experienced with Mentor breast implants is generally well-managed and controlled with appropriate pain medication and post-operative care. However, it's important for patients to have realistic expectations and to discuss any concerns or questions they may have with their plastic surgeon. By working closely with a qualified and experienced surgeon, patients can maximize their comfort and achieve the desired aesthetic results.
